We use cookies and similar technologies to enable services and functionality on our site and to understand your interaction with our service. Privacy policy
Learn more about our services
Learn more about how MarketGuard AML compliance software can assist a European VASP and CASP with blockchain transaction monitoring and Travel Rule
In the rapidly evolving world of cryptocurrencies, storing digital assets securely is a top priority for both casual and experienced users. One of the most popular methods to store crypto securely is through the use of a self-hosted wallet. A self-hosted wallet offers users complete control over their cryptocurrency, providing an additional layer of privacy and security compared to hosted wallets that rely on third-party services. This article explores the concept of self-hosted wallets, the different types available, and their advantages and potential risks.
A self-hosted wallet, also known as a non-custodial wallet or unhosted wallet, is a type of crypto wallet that gives users full control over their private keys and digital assets. Unlike a hosted wallet, where a third-party service (such as a crypto exchange or online platform) manages the wallet and holds the user’s private keys, a self-hosted wallet allows users to store, manage, and access their cryptocurrency without relying on any external party.
With self-hosted wallets, users store their assets on their own devices, making them responsible for the safety and security of their funds. This type of wallet comes in multiple forms, including hot wallets (connected to the internet) and cold wallets (offline storage), each with its unique security measures.
A self-hosted wallet works by giving the user control over their private key, which is necessary to access and manage their crypto assets. A private key is a cryptographic code that is used to sign and authorize transactions. This key must remain secure, as anyone with access to it can control the wallet and transfer funds. The wallet itself interacts with the blockchain, the distributed ledger that tracks all cryptocurrency transactions.
When a user sets up a self-hosted wallet, they are typically provided with a recovery phrase or seed phrase, which consists of a series of words that act as a backup for the private key. If the user loses access to their wallet or their device, they can recover their funds by using this seed phrase. Because of the high level of control users have over their funds, it’s important to store the seed phrase and private keys in a secure location.
Self-hosted wallets come in several forms, each providing varying levels of security and usability. These wallets can be categorized into hot wallets and cold wallets, depending on their connection to the internet.
Hardware Wallets
A hardware wallet is a type of cold storage or cold wallet that stores private keys on a physical device, such as a USB stick or specialized hardware designed to securely store cryptocurrency. Examples include popular brands like Ledger and Trezor. Hardware wallets are considered one of the most secure methods for storing cryptocurrencies because they are not connected to the internet, reducing the risk of hacking or other potential vulnerabilities.
Software Wallets (Hot Wallets)
Hot wallets are software-based wallets that are connected to the internet, making them more accessible but less secure than cold wallets. These wallets can be installed on a user's device, such as a desktop computer or mobile phone, allowing them to store and manage their crypto assets directly. Examples include wallets like MetaMask, Trust Wallet, and Exodus.
Mobile Wallets
Mobile wallets are apps designed for smartphones, offering a user-friendly interface for managing and transferring cryptocurrency. These wallets are convenient for day-to-day use but can be more vulnerable to hacking if the phone is compromised.
Paper Wallets
Paper wallets are a form of cold storage where the user’s private keys are printed or written down on paper. While this method is entirely offline, the physical nature of the paper wallet makes it susceptible to damage or loss, and accessing the funds can be cumbersome.
Complete Control
The most significant advantage of a self-hosted wallet is the full control it provides users over their private keys and funds. Unlike hosted wallets where a third party holds the keys, users of self-hosted wallets are the sole owners of their cryptocurrency.
Enhanced Security
Self-hosted wallets, particularly cold wallets like hardware wallets, offer enhanced security by keeping private keys offline. This reduces the risk of online threats such as hacking and phishing attacks. For users concerned about network security and the safety of their funds, cold storage offers a robust solution.
Privacy and Anonymity
Since self-hosted wallets do not rely on third parties to manage assets, they allow for greater privacy. Users can transact with their crypto assets without needing to provide personal information to a centralized entity. This makes self-hosted wallets a preferred choice for those who prioritize privacy in the crypto space.
User Responsibility
While self-hosted wallets offer users full control, they also place the entire burden of security on the user. Losing access to the private key or recovery phrase means permanent loss of the crypto assets, as there is no third party to recover the funds.
Technical Complexity
Self-hosted wallets can be more challenging to set up and use compared to hosted wallets. Managing private keys, implementing security measures like two-factor authentication, and safely storing recovery phrases requires technical knowledge, which can be daunting for new users.
Potential Vulnerabilities
Though cold wallets are generally secure, hot wallets—being connected to the internet—are more vulnerable to hacking. Users must take extra precautions, such as ensuring their devices are free from malware, to protect their funds.
As the use of self-hosted wallets grows, regulatory authorities are increasingly interested in how these wallets interact with legal frameworks, particularly regarding anti-money laundering (AML) and know your customer (KYC) regulations. For example, the Travel Rule, issued by the Financial Action Task Force (FATF), requires Virtual Asset Service Providers (VASPs) to collect and share transaction information about the originator and recipient. Self-hosted wallets pose a challenge to this rule, as they are not under the control of any regulated institution.
In many jurisdictions, regulatory frameworks are still being developed to address the use of self-hosted wallets. Users must be aware of the rules in their country, as they can affect the legality and reporting requirements for certain types of transactions.
To ensure maximum security when using a self-hosted wallet, users should follow these best practices:
Secure Your Private Key
Always store your private key and recovery phrase in a secure location, away from prying eyes and potential threats. Consider using physical security measures, like a safe or a safety deposit box.
Use a Hardware Wallet for Long-Term Storage
For users holding large amounts of crypto assets or planning to store funds for an extended period, using a hardware wallet is recommended. These physical devices keep your keys offline, minimizing the risk of cyberattacks.
Enable Two-Factor Authentication (2FA)
If using a hot wallet or any wallet connected to the internet, always enable two-factor authentication (2FA) to add an extra layer of security to your wallet.
Backup Your Wallet
Regularly back up your wallet to ensure you can recover your funds in case of device failure or loss. This typically involves securely storing your recovery phrase.
Stay Informed About Regulatory Changes
As regulations surrounding self-hosted wallets evolve, staying informed about the legal requirements in your jurisdiction is crucial to avoid potential legal risks.
Self-hosted wallets offer users unparalleled control and security over their crypto assets, but they also come with increased responsibility. By understanding how these wallets work, the risks involved, and the best practices for securing them, users can confidently navigate the crypto space and ensure their digital funds remain safe. As the industry continues to evolve, tools like hardware wallets, combined with secure practices and compliance solutions, will continue to play a crucial role in keeping users’ crypto wallets secure.